What Is a Wrongful Death Case?
A wrongful death claim is a civil tort action that allows a family to recover compensation when a loved one’s death is the result of an accident, defective product, or act of violence. State law provides a cause of action for wrongful death when a person’s death is caused by the “wrongful act or omission of another person.”
If the victim is a child, the parent(s) reserve the right to file a wrongful death lawsuit against the responsible party for damages. If the victim is an adult, the personal representative of their estate must bring the wrongful death claim on behalf of the surviving spouse, child(ren), parent(s), or other surviving family members.
What’s My Wrongful Death Claim Worth?
It’s hard to say without knowing specific facts about your case, your loved one, and your family dynamics.
However, you can get a sense of what your wrongful death case could be worth by considering the following:
- What was the decedent’s average income before they died?
- How much financial support did they provide for their family?
- Did they offer considerable support in running a household or raising a family?
- How old were they before they passed away?
- What was their life expectancy before they were fatally wounded?
- Is the insurance company blaming the victim for the fatal accident?
- How close were the decedent and the surviving heirs?
The stronger the bond between the decedent and the heirs, and the more the family relied on the decedent for financial and household support, the more a related wrongful death claim could potentially be worth.
What Damages Can Be Awarded in a Carmel Wrongful Death Lawsuit?
It depends on who survives the decedent and intends to benefit from the wrongful death case. Indiana law has specific types of damages that can be awarded based on the relationship between the decedent and the heir.
When a victim is survived by a parent or adult children, but no spouse, damages for loss of love and companionship for up to $300,000 can be awarded if the parent or child can prove that they had a “genuine, substantial, and ongoing relationship” with the decedent.
Additional compensation for medical bills and funeral expenses can be awarded to the decedent’s estate, where they’ll be subject to distribution pursuant to a will or Indiana intestacy law.
When a victim is survived by a spouse and/or dependent children, the following damages can be awarded:
- Loss of future earnings and financial support
- Loss of love, care, and affection
Damages for funeral expenses and medical bills can also be awarded to the estate.

What If My Loved One is Partly at Fault For Their Fatal Accident?
It can limit your family’s ability to get compensation for their wrongful death. Indiana’s modified comparative negligence doctrine applies to personal injury cases, including matters of wrongful death. For wrongful death cases, it’s the decedent’s shared fault that’s at issue.
Damages can be awarded to surviving heirs as long as the decedent’s shared fault isn’t greater than 50 percent. In these situations, damages would be reduced based on the decedent’s degree of blame. If your spouse was killed in a Carmel car accident and determined to be 15 percent to blame for the deadly crash, any civil financial recovery related to their death could be reduced by 15 percent.
Once a decedent’s contributory fault is greater than half, the right to bring a wrongful death claim for damages against another party is lost – even if that other party is also to blame.
What’s the Statute of Limitations on Wrongful Death Lawsuits in Indiana?
Two years. Indiana gives the personal representative of a decedent’s estate two years from the date of their passing to file a wrongful death lawsuit for damages.
Once the two-year statute of limitations runs out, family members lose the ability to receive compensation for their heartbreaking loss.
